Culture and Etiquette

Mongolia has a large number of customs and traditions - visitors should respect local customs and also try to familiarise themselves with them as far as possible.
Photography is not permitted in temples and monasteries, while in some places fees for photography may be payable. Caution should be exercised when photographing official buildings or borders.
Food (as well as other items) are always passed and received with the right hand, while the left hand touches the right elbow for symbolical support.
A guest entering a ger will always be given something to eat. It is not possible to reject the offer, but it isn't necessary to empty the bowl either. Taking a small bite or a sip satisfies the etiquette, and the rest may be returned without difficulty. An empty bowl will be refilled immediately.
